(二)安裝RPL無盤DOS 由于Windows 3.2需要DOS支持,因此,在制作基于Windows 3.2的RPL無盤終端之前,需要先使無盤工作站能夠?qū)崿F(xiàn)RPL無盤DOS的啟動。
1.為Windows .NET安裝遠程啟動服務(wù)
由于微軟從Windows 2000開始就摒棄了Windows NT中固有的、制作RPL無盤站所必需的遠程啟動服務(wù),所以Windows.NET Server并不能自動支持遠程啟動,這就得借助第三方軟件來為它安裝遠程啟動服務(wù)補丁。
(1)安裝協(xié)議補丁:
遠程啟動服務(wù)的運行需要“NWLink NetBIOS”、“NWLink IPX/SPX/NetBIOS Compatible Transport Protocol”、“NetBEUI Protocol”和“DLC Protocol”四種協(xié)議的支持。而Windows.NET Server缺少后兩種協(xié)議(即“NetBEUI Protocol”和“DLC Protocol”),因此安裝協(xié)議補丁是絕對有必要的。
如果服務(wù)器中同時裝有兩種操作系統(tǒng)(比如除了Windows.NET Server之外,還有Windows 2000),則進入另外一個系統(tǒng),將“addnet.zip”解壓到Windows.NET Server的系統(tǒng)目錄中(比如為“E:\WINDOWS”目錄),覆蓋原有內(nèi)容即可安裝好協(xié)議補丁。
如果服務(wù)器中只有Windows.NET Server一種系統(tǒng),而且Windows.NET Server被安裝在NTFS分區(qū)中,但至少有一個FAT或FAT32位分區(qū),則安裝協(xié)議補丁可按如下步驟進行操作:
在Windows.NET Server中將“ntfspro.zip”和“netbug.zip”文件分別解壓到FAT或FAT32分區(qū)中,則系統(tǒng)會自動建立相關(guān)的目錄,比如分別為“D:\NTFSPRO”目錄和“D:\NETBUG”目錄。
用DOS 6.22或Windows 98的啟動軟盤(或光盤)啟動服務(wù)器到DOS狀態(tài)下,進入“NTFSPRO”目錄(不一定仍是D盤),執(zhí)行里面的“ntfspro.exe”文件,系統(tǒng)就會將本機中所有的NTFS分區(qū)找出來,并為它們分配相應(yīng)的驅(qū)動器符。
假設(shè)映射后的Windows.NET Server所在分區(qū)為E盤,則進入“NETBUG”目錄,執(zhí)行“arj x bug e:\windows /yes”即可。
(2)添加所需協(xié)議:
當(dāng)協(xié)議補丁安裝成功之后,重新啟動服務(wù)器進入Windows.NET Server,然后按照如下步驟來添加所需的四種協(xié)議:
確保已在服務(wù)器上正確安裝好了網(wǎng)卡,然后右擊“網(wǎng)上鄰居”圖標(biāo),選擇“屬性”命令。
任意選中一個“本地連接”圖標(biāo),在其上右擊,選擇“屬性”命令,在打開的對話框中,先點擊“安裝”按鈕進入“選擇網(wǎng)絡(luò)組件類型”對話框,接著雙擊列表中的“協(xié)議”圖標(biāo)進入“選擇網(wǎng)絡(luò)協(xié)議”對話框,然后雙擊列表中的“NWLink IPX/SPX/NetBIOS Compatible Transport Protocol”圖標(biāo)。
注意:Windows.NET Server中,在添加“NWLink IPX/SPX/NetBIOS Compatible Transport Protocol”協(xié)議的同時,“NWLink NetBIOS”協(xié)議也會自動被添加進去。
再按上述的方法逐個添加“NetBEUI Protocol”和“DLC Protocol”兩種協(xié)議。
點擊“本地連接屬性”對話框中的“確定”按鈕,保存退出后即完成了添加所需協(xié)議的操作。
(3)安裝遠程啟動服務(wù)補。
本處所用的遠程啟動服務(wù)補丁是“Win2000遠程啟動器”(rplw2k_zy.exe),它在Windows.NET Server中安裝的具體方法和步驟如下:
雙擊安裝文件“rplw2k_zy.exe”進入“Win2000遠程啟動器”對話框,里面包含有作者信息及注意事項等內(nèi)容。點擊“確定”按鈕后進入解壓對話框后,系統(tǒng)會自動將所有相關(guān)文件解壓到“C:\RPL”目錄中去。
解壓完成后系統(tǒng)會自動彈出一個文本文件,可以在里面看到此軟件的簡介和后續(xù)操作的說明。關(guān)閉說明文件,進入“C:\RPL”目錄,雙擊注冊表文件“rpl.reg”打開“注冊表編輯器”對話框,此時系統(tǒng)會詢問“是否確認(rèn)要將C:\RPL\rpl.reg中的信息添加進注冊表”,點擊“是(Y)”按鈕接受對注冊表的更新。
關(guān)閉所有窗口,重新啟動服務(wù)器,再次進入Windows.NET Server后,依次點擊“開始→程序→管理工具→服務(wù)”項,進入“服務(wù)”窗口,在右邊框架中將滾動條拖到最下面,此時可以看到“名稱”中有“遠程啟動服務(wù)”項,并且其“狀態(tài)”為“已啟動”,“啟動類別”為“自動”,即說明遠程啟動服務(wù)器已經(jīng)添加成功。
2.安裝RPL無盤DOS站
當(dāng)遠程啟動服務(wù)安裝好之后,不再需要重新啟動,就可以直接進行RPL無盤DOS站的安裝了。
(1)復(fù)制DOS系統(tǒng)文件:
要安裝無盤站,服務(wù)器端就必須要存放有無盤工作站需要運行的操作系統(tǒng),它是用來接受工作站的遠程啟動請求的。無盤DOS站的安裝自然也不例外,需要使用到DOS的系統(tǒng)文件。建議采用DOS 6.22版。
這里所需要的DOS系統(tǒng)文件可以自己準(zhǔn)備(具體操作請查閱相關(guān)資料),也可以直接使用筆者為你準(zhǔn)備好的壓縮包文件“dos622.zip”,操作時只需將它里面所有內(nèi)容解壓到服務(wù)器的“C:\RPL\RPLFILES\BINFILES\DOS622”目錄中覆蓋原有內(nèi)容就行了(不需要重新啟動)。
(2)配置工作站網(wǎng)卡:
對于絕大多數(shù)工作站網(wǎng)卡來說,要想完成無盤啟動,必須要先要網(wǎng)卡本身能夠被遠程啟動服務(wù)器所設(shè)別,這就需要配置工作站網(wǎng)卡。
本文中工作站端網(wǎng)卡配置文件的建立(服務(wù)器端網(wǎng)卡不需進行此配置)均以RTL 8139(網(wǎng)卡號前6位為00E04C)為例,其他網(wǎng)卡的操作請參照執(zhí)行:
在服務(wù)器端,復(fù)制其網(wǎng)卡驅(qū)動程序盤中的NDIS驅(qū)動程序文件“rtsnd.dos”到“C:\RPL\BBLOCK\NDIS”目錄中去。
轉(zhuǎn)到“C:\RPL\BBLOCK\NETBEUI”目錄,在里面新建一個子目錄,比如為“8139”,再復(fù)制“C:\RPL\BBLOCK\NETBEUI\NE2000”目錄中的“dosbb.cnf”和“protocol.ini”兩個文件到剛建立好的“8139”目錄中去。
用記事本打開“8139”目錄中的“dosbb.cnf”文件,將里面的“DAT BBLOCK\NETBEUI\NE2000\PROTOCOL.INI”行改為“DAT BBLOCK\NETBEUI\8139\PROTOCOL.INI”(不區(qū)分大小寫,下同),再將“DRV BBLOCK\NDIS\NE2000.DOS”行改為“DRV BBLOCK\NDIS\RTSND.DOS”,然后保存退出“dosbb.cnf”文件。
用記事本打開“8139”目錄中的“protocol.ini”文件,按“Ctrl+H”組合鍵,根據(jù)提示將所有的“MS2000”全替換為“RTSND”,然后保存退出“protocol.ini”文件。
執(zhí)行“C:\RPL”目錄中的“rplcmd.exe”文件,以運行為此網(wǎng)卡建立無盤遠程啟動配置文件的程序,并嚴(yán)格根據(jù)屏幕提示按如下內(nèi)容進行操作即可:
適配器引導(dǎo) Config 配置文件服務(wù)代理商 Wksta[ 退出 ]:V(設(shè)置網(wǎng)卡廠商的名稱)
添加 Del Enum:A(添加)
VendorName=00E04C(工作站網(wǎng)卡號的前6位)
所有其他參數(shù)都是可選的
VendorComment=VC8139(可為任意內(nèi)容)
適配器引導(dǎo) Config 配置文件服務(wù)代理商 Wksta[ 退出 ]:B(修改啟動塊記錄)
添加 Del Enum:A(添加)
BootName=BN8139(可為任意內(nèi)容,但一定要和下文的BootName項一致)
VendorName=00E04C(工作站網(wǎng)卡號的前6位)
BbcFile=BBLOCK\NETBEUI\8139\DOSBB.CNF(指定“dosbb.cnf”文件的保存路徑)
所有其他參數(shù)都是可選的
BootComment=BC8139(可為任意內(nèi)容)
WindowSize=(直接按回車鍵跳過)
適配器引導(dǎo) Config 配置文件服務(wù)代理商 Wksta[ 退出 ]:C(修改配置文件)
添加 Del Enum:A(添加)
ConfigName=CN8139(可為任意內(nèi)容)
BootName=BN8139(可為任意內(nèi)容,但一定要和上文的“BootName”項一致)
DirName=DOS(固定)
DirName2=DOS622(固定)
FitShared=FITS\DOS622.FIT(固定)
FitPersonal=FITS\DOS622P.FIT(固定)
所有其他參數(shù)都是可選的
ConfigComment=0 00E04C(可為任意內(nèi)容,但建議為較靠前的字母或數(shù)字加網(wǎng)卡號)
DirName3=(直接按回車鍵跳過)
DirName4=(直接按回車鍵跳過)
適配器引導(dǎo) Config 配置文件服務(wù)代理商 Wksta[ 退出 ]:Q(完成后退出配置)
說明:加下劃線部分需手工輸入,其他部分均為系統(tǒng)自動顯示;需要手工輸入部分的內(nèi)容,大小寫不限;每輸完一項之后均按回車鍵繼續(xù);“()”里面為筆者加的注釋,未注釋處強烈建議照原樣輸入!
出處:藍色理想
責(zé)任編輯:劍氣凌人
上一頁 無盤終端網(wǎng)組建(續(xù)三) 下一頁 無盤終端網(wǎng)組建(續(xù)五)
|